A man was arrested Wednesday on allegations that he was driving under the influence of narcotics when he passed out in the drive-thru lane at a bank believing that he was at a Taco Bell. 28-year-old Douglas Francisco pulled into the drive-up teller lane at a Hernando County branch of Bank of America and reportedly lost consciousness behind the wheel. Tenth Circuit: No need to overturn the tax evasion and related convictions of Douglas Bruce, the former Colorado state legislator who wrote the state's Taxpayer Bill of Rights, which requires legislators to submit a ballot initiative to the voters whenever they want to raise taxes. [read post]

Field Marshal Sir Douglas Haig, Britain’s senior military commander, was very far outside the general consensus of British public opinion when he estimated that the loss of one in ten British young men in uniform was not too steep a price to pay for victory. [read post]
